Church Fathers on Job 42:3

Who is he that hideth counsel without knowledge? For Leviathan hides counsel without knowledge, because, though he is concealed from our infirmity by many frauds, he is yet disclosed to us by the holy inspiration of our Protector. He hides counsel without knowledge, because though he escapes the notice of those who are tempted, yet he cannot escape the notice of the Protector of the tempted. Having heard therefore the power and craft of the devil, having heard also the power…

Gregory the Great · 6th century · Morals on Job, Book 35 §2
